Negentropy
A measure of system complexity, order, or predictability; often considered the opposite of entropy.
Entropy
A measure of disorder or randomness in a system, often associated with the second law of thermodynamics, indicating the degree of dispersion of energy.
Hypertrophy
The enlargement of an organ or tissue from the increase in size of its cells, often related to physical exercise.
